473 mL can from the LCBO; coded Mar 22 2020 and served barely chilled. The code indicates that it was brewed at the AB-InBev (Labatt) facility in Montreal.
Pours a crystal clear, pale golden-yellow, generating nearly one finger of fizzy white head that sizzles off within about thirty seconds. No cap or lace, just a thin non-descript collar; yep, it looks like a light beer. The nose is too sugary for my tastes: I'm getting more strawberry than lemonade, and essentially nothing else. I don't know what else I was expecting.
It's ok - still rather sweet, don't get me wrong, but not quite as brutally saccharine as the nose might've suggested. The strawberry comes first, then the lemonade, with the sugar remaining a fixture through to the finish; you can kind of taste the underlying Bud Light flavour at that point, but it's minimal. Light in body, with moderately assertive carbonation that provides an appropriately crisp, prickly texture for this sort of brew. And I use the term 'brew' loosely, because this is not at all beer-like.
Final Grade: 3.02, a C+. I don't have too much else to say about Bud Light Strawberry Lemonade. It delivers exactly what it says on the package, i.e. a Bud Light flavoured with strawberry and heavily sweetened lemonade. If that sounds good to you, don't hesitate to pick this one up, but it'll be a one and done for me - I'd rather be drinking their Bud Light Grapefruit radler, which is still the best one of these fruity experiments they've put out so far IMO. Hell, I'd probably take Bud Light Lime over this one, simply because it's not so goddamn sweet.
